Output ed4921c0a7288efcfe6c8c630dcde4fa8341313bbc1d72c773600bb259965f87:26

value
724342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e8f4222ada9806de97a4f292d590ce27d21c883 OP_EQUAL
address
38rQFGea45dAbTYgP1dCvjHaJDWd1xsAea
transaction
ed4921c0a7288efcfe6c8c630dcde4fa8341313bbc1d72c773600bb259965f87
confirmations
163032
spent
true